Installing the Audio Driver and the Modem Driver

(Windows 98)

The audio driver allows you to customize the sound features of your computer. Install-
ing the audio driver also installs the modem driver, which allows you to use your
computer to send and receive information over telephone lines. To install the audio
and modem drivers, perform the following steps:
1.
Save your work in all open application programs because you will need to restart
your computer at the end of this procedure to complete the installation.
2.
Insert the System Software CD into the CD-ROM drive.
3.
Click the Start button, and then click Run.
The Run dialog box appears.
4.
Type x:\win98\audio\setup, where x is the drive letter of your CD-ROM
drive, and click OK or press <Enter>.
5.
Follow the instructions on the screen.
6.
After the files are copied to your hard-disk drive, remove the System Software CD
from the CD-ROM drive, and click Finish to restart your computer.
Installing the DualPoint Integrated Pointing Device
Drivers (Windows 98)
DualPoint integrated pointing device drivers and associated utilities allow you to use
and customize the integrated touch pad, track stick, or external mouse. To install
these drivers, perform the following steps.
NOTICE: Use these steps to install touch pad drivers only if your computer
has a track stick. If your computer does not have a track stick, follow the
instructions in the next section, "Installing the Touch Pad Drivers."
1.
Save your work in all open application programs because you will need to restart
your computer at the end of this procedure to complete the installation.
2.
Insert the System Utilities CD into the CD-ROM drive.
3.
Click the Start button, and then click Run.
The Run dialog box appears.
4.
Type x:\win98\touchpad\dual\setup, where x is the drive letter of your
CD-ROM drive, and click OK or press <Enter>.
5.
Follow the instructions on the screen.
6.
After the files are copied to your hard-disk drive, remove the System Software CD
from the CD-ROM drive, and click Finish to restart your computer.
